This role is for a more junior associate looking to grow in a ETL, data mining/analytics and automation career. ------ This is an individual contributor role that would be paired with other more senior team members on the Enterprise Catastrophe Risk Management (ECRM) Data Team (DMAT). DMAT is responsible for collecting, storing, validating, and publishing Nationwide’s Property data for Catastrophe Risk Management purposes and beyond. The ideal candidate would have a similar passion for data collection and validation. Unlike other ETL roles, on this team we own the process from beginning to end, we have insight into the “why” our data is critical and the “how” it impacts the Enterprise as a whole. In this role, you will be responsible for meaningful work that impacts Nationwide's bottom line. Because this role straddles the line between IT Professional, Property Underwriter, and Product Manager, the ideal candidate would be familiar with all three aspects of insurance or have a willingness to learn. Eventually, the candidate will be expected to know the business sufficiently to make accurate decisions with the data during validation efforts and reporting.
